Stanford fellow delivers hope for Monterey County water collaboration
Could the limited successes in bringing together disparate water interests in the San Joaquin Valley be a model for a collaborative solution to the water woes facing Monterey County? Local elected officials on Tuesday listened to an architect of such an effort in the neighboring valley in hopes that the growing loggerheads over securing additional, permanent water sources in Monterey County can be alleviated…. the Board of Supervisors invited Tim Quinn, a Stanford University Landreth Visiting Fellow and past president of the Association of California Water Agencies, to brief them on the work he and colleagues have put in to bring farmers, environmentalists, social justice advocates, governments and water agencies together….
